Pac-12 power rankings, Week 7: Wildcats dip, dip, dive

Even though they had a bye week, the Arizona Wildcats are falling down the Pac-12 power rankings heading into a game against the USC Trojans.

1. Oregon

Last week: Oregon 57, Colorado 16

Trending: --

As the always-positive Rick Neuheisel tends to say, "don't give up on Colorado." The Buffs put some early points up on the Ducks before Mark Helfrich's defense turned the lights off.

2. Stanford

Last week: Stanford 31, Washington 28

Trending: --

Who wants to bet that Pac-12 commissioner Larry Scott phoned in to the referee's review booth in the slim win against Washington? He likely told the ref he had damn well reverse the fourth-down conversion by UW quarterback Keith Price in the final minutes. Got to keep Oregon and Stanford perfect for that natty game, you know.

3. UCLA

Last week: UCLA 34, Utah 27

Trending: --

In a very Stanford-esque type of way, UCLA figured out how to win on the road against a Utah Utes team that didn't look all that bad. They're the favorites in the Pac-12 South, by far.

4. Washington

Last week: Stanford 31, Washington 28

Trending: --

Washington has done nothing wrong and nothing to paint them as illegitimate. But alas, the Pac-12 officiating did something screwy in the finals minutes to take away what might have been a game-winning or game-tying drive against the Cardinal.

5. ASU

Last week: Notre Dame 37, Arizona State 34

Trending: --

After whipping USC, it was odd that the Sun Devils struggled in many phases against a Notre Dame team that has been hot and cold this year. Despite the loss, ASU is still set in the top-five of the league.

6. Utah

Last week: UCLA 34, Utah 27

Trending: ^^^

Utah's defense is no joke and its offense is gaining steam. Though the Utes didn't pull off a win against the Bruins this week, they put a huge scare into Jim Mora's squad. Call this week The Week of Almosts.

7. Washington State

Last week: Washington State 44, Cal 22

Trending: Up

Mike Leach got the best of his former protege Sonny Dykes. The win for the Cougars might've said less than the loss for the Golden Bears, but WSU is 4-2. Things are looking up in Pullman.

8. Oregon State

Last week: Bye

Trending: ^^

Offensive line health has been an issue for the Beavs. Finally, they should be ready to get some reinforcements for a Week 7 battle against Oregon State.

9. Arizona

Last week: Bye

Trending: Down

Uh, oh. That whole having a quarterback thing is turning out poorly. I prematurely have dropped the Wildcats from sixth to ninth after the UW loss and during the bye. The bad news is that I have the angry Ed Orgeron-led Trojans  at 10th before they play Arizona this Thursday. UA could fall again next week -- or could hang tight if WSU, OSU or Utah looks especially bad.

10. USC

Last week: Bye

Trending: Down

USC fired a head coach from my last power rankings post. But you know, they still have talent.

11. Cal

Last week: Washington State 44, Cal 22

Trending: --

It's official. The rebuilding project for former UA offensive coordinator is very, very real.

12. Colorado

Last week: Oregon 57, Colorado 16

Trending: --

Hard to move up from the bottom when you play the best team in the Pac-12. Don't give up on Colorado! But seriously, at this rate, the Buffs might be able to give Arizona a good game.
